Biblical Meaning of Walking as a Christian

The Bible often uses the imagery of walking to describe our spiritual journey. In Galatians 5:16, it encourages us to “walk by the Spirit.” This means allowing the Holy Spirit to guide our decisions and actions. I've found that embracing this guidance helps align my actions with God's will.

Moreover, walking as a Christian represents a commitment to growth. Just like physical walking strengthens our bodies, spiritual walking strengthens our faith. I've seen firsthand how commitment to daily prayer and scripture reading has transformed my understanding and relationship with God.

Challenges in Walking as a Christian

While walking as a Christian is rewarding, it comes with its share of challenges. Recognizing these obstacles can help us prepare to face them head-on.

Facing Doubt and Fear

I've often encountered moments of doubt on my journey. It's easy to question whether I'm truly walking as a Christian when life gets tough. During these times, I've found it helpful to lean on prayer and Scripture for reassurance.

Reading stories of biblical figures who faced doubt can be comforting. For instance, Peter walked on water until fear overtook him. Remembering these stories reminds me that doubt is a part of faith, but it doesn't define it.

Overcoming Distractions

In today’s fast-paced world, distractions are everywhere. From social media to daily pressures, I've realized that these can hinder my ability to focus on walking as a Christian. Setting aside specific times for prayer and reflection helps mitigate these distractions.

I also recommend disconnecting from technology periodically. This allows for deeper moments of connection with God, free from the noise of the world.
